A large Buddha statue in a temple with a crowd of people around it.

Todaiji Temple

9.2/10 (2,261 reviews)
Home to one of the world's largest wooden buildings and a towering 15-meter bronze Buddha statue. Wander through ancient halls as friendly sacred deer roam the surrounding Nara Park.

A traditional Japanese building with a tiled roof, wooden beams, and a stone staircase leading to the entrance.

Nara National Museum

8.6/10 (200 reviews)
This renowned sanctuary of Buddhist art houses nearly 100 ancient statues and treasures from the Nara period. Visit during autumn's Shosoin Exhibition to witness rare artifacts displayed only once yearly.

A traditional Japanese pagoda surrounded by lush greenery.

Kofuku-ji Temple

9.2/10 (425 reviews)
This 8th-century temple showcases Japan's second tallest wooden pagoda and exquisite Buddhist art. Stroll the serene grounds in morning light, when the ancient structures cast their longest shadows.

A large bell hanging from a wooden structure with traditional Japanese architecture in the background.

Yakushi-ji Temple

9.0/10 (322 reviews)
This 7th-century temple houses the exquisite East Pagoda, Japan's only surviving original structure from the era. Explore the serene grounds to admire the bronze Yakushi Triad statues representing the Healing Buddha.

Best time to go to Nara

The best time to visit Nara can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Nara fal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Nara fal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January39.2°F (4.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
March47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
May64.9°F (18.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June71.6°F (22.0°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July79.2°F (26.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August81.3°F (27.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
September74.5°F (23.6°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
October63.9°F (17.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
November54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
December43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age

What's the weather like in Nara?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 77°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 43°F. The rainiest months in Nara are July, June, September, and October,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
